Output f5ea8103b6e5a6bd35780eebf05dc6fd54328126d2a155df5773cdc5c019bf4d:0

value
5014930275
script pubkey
OP_PUSHBYTES_65 04e2589cb23cbefb39578174a6886a91582aa29589162a3b749b414d6c2ae7a45f39e5973f6c4e8ab738e8e996b3dad12b63148129cf3f76e7448ae89d69c39cd7 OP_CHECKSIG
transaction
f5ea8103b6e5a6bd35780eebf05dc6fd54328126d2a155df5773cdc5c019bf4d
confirmations
815310
spent
true